Dera Natung Government College, Itanagar, is an institute of higher education in Arunachal Pradesh, India. It was established in 1979 and later affiliated to Rajiv Gandhi University (earlier known as Arunachal University).[1]

History[]

Housed in the Government Higher Secondary School Building, it began its educational pursuits in the evening shift with four one-man departments of English, Hindi, Economics and History and with a handful of students. It shifted to its own building complex on its permanent site in 1986. In 2005, the college received NAAC Accreditation Grade of B+.[citation needed]

Overview[]

The college is located centrally in the Vivek Vihar sector of the town; it has an area of 80 acres (320,000 m2). Since its inception it had been imparting education with day and night shifts till 1990, when the night shift was abolished.[citation needed]

The college is connected by road with the rest of the country by the National Highway No.52 A through Banderdewa check post. The nearest railway station is Naharlagun, at a distance of 30;km. and the airport is Lilabari at a distance of 75 km.[citation needed]
